摘要
We proposed and experimentally demonstrated a sensitive, label-free, real-time and low-cost optofluidic microcavity biosensor for DNA detection. The change of whispering gallery mode (WGM) resonant wavelength is monitored by data acquisition card in real-time. The experimental results show that the biosensor can significantly distinguish the non-complementary single strand (ssDNA), single nucleotide mismatch ssDNA, and target ssDNA. In addition, a sensing mechanism based on WGM coupling depth was also experimentally demonstrated which would have potential for detection of biological and chemical analytes in the future.
